About Noradjuha
Noradjuha is a small rural locality in Victoria's Wimmera region, located approximately 25 kilometres south-west of Horsham within the Rural City of Horsham. The area extends across about 181 square kilometres of flat to gently rolling grain-growing country, positioned roughly midway between Melbourne and Adelaide along the Western Highway corridor. The 2021 census recorded a population of 89, reflecting a sparse rural settlement typical of the Wimmera's broad agricultural plains.
The Wimmera region is one of Australia's most important grain-growing areas, and Noradjuha sits at the heart of this vast agricultural landscape dominated by wheat, barley, and canola crops. The locality has a quiet, close-knit community character, with residents relying on Horsham — the major regional centre of the Wimmera — for shopping, healthcare, education, and employment. Horsham is approximately 25 kilometres to the north-east and offers a full range of services including hospitals, schools, and retail centres.
Noradjuha falls under postcode 3401 and is governed by the Horsham Council (Local Government Area). For federal elections, residents vote in the electorate of Wannon, while state elections fall under the Lowan (Western Victoria) electorate.
